user::=
USER
returns the name of the session user (the user who logged on) with the datatype VARCHAR2
. Oracle compares values of this function with blank-padded comparison semantics.
In a distributed SQL statement, the UID
and USER
functions identify the user on your local database. You cannot use these functions in the condition of a CHECK
constraint.
The following example returns the current user and the user's UID:
SELECT USER, UID FROM DUAL;
